Relaxation Space in an Interior
Zhang, Meng Jie ; Elfmark, Ondřej (referee) ; Zdařil, Zdeněk (advisor)
The chair is designed for people who need their own peaceful space to hide and relax. The chair is put together with pentagonal shapes which ergonomically houses the human body. The geometrical structure allows the user to feel protected and cosy, almost immune to the outside world. The chair is made of oak wood and it fits for busy hotels, airports, offices and libraries.

Návrh nábytkového prvku s využitím materiálu z houbového mycelia
Paulasová, Dominika
The thesis deals with the options for using fungal mycelium in the field of furniture. The aim was to design a furniture element so that the material’s prope-rties are taken into account. The theoretical part provides information on the ma-terial, its production, properties and processing possibilities. The literature re-view gives an insight into the current development of mycelium materials and the options for their use. The practical part deals with the design of a bench whose seat is made of mycelium composite. The experimental part thus includes mea-surements of selected material characteristics such as impact resistance, Brinell scale hardness, density profile, flakiness and flexure. The measurements compare samples with different input parameters such as the time the mycelium grew and initial densification during moulding.
Biopolyméry v čalúnenom nábytku - design sedacieho prvku
Kočická, Barbora
The main topic of this diploma thesis is to survey possibilities of applications of biopolymers in upholstery furniture. Also it takes aim to apply chosen bioplastic in design of seating element. First part of this thesis mentions requests on soft seating and contemporary materials, as well as background for eco-friendly design. Theoretical part consist of material research mapping current market of biopolymers possibly used in upholstery furniture production and interior architecture. This knowledge serves as a base for own design of soft seating element respecting safety and ergonomic request and accessible technologies.
